Service Desk Analyst Courses in Queensland

Service Desk Analysts troubleshoot software and hardware issues, providing technical support via phone, chat, and email for various organisations.

In Australia, a full time Service Desk Analyst generally earns $1,300 per week ($67,600 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ience and technical expertise you can expect a higher salary than people who are new to the role.

Opportunities for Service Desk Analysts are expected to grow strongly over the next 5 years as more than 62,000 jobs open up around the country. Service Desk Analysts are employed by IT firms, hardware and software companies, private enterprise, educational bodies, and government departments.

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ights

Service Desk Analysts need a solid ICT background or formal qualifications. The Certificate III in Information Technology or the Certificate IV in Programming are excellent ways to get started. Both qualifications can be completed in 12-18 months.

If you're looking to start a career in IT, exploring Service Desk Analyst courses in Queensland is a fantastic option. With a range of courses tailored for both beginners and experienced learners, you can find the right educational path to suit your needs. Popular beginner courses such as the Certificate III in Information Technology ICT30120 and the Entry to Tech Skill Set ICTSS00109 provide an excellent foundation for those with no prior experience. These courses are designed to equip you with essential IT skills, preparing you for a variety of roles in the tech industry.

For those who already have some experience or qualifications, advanced courses like the Certificate IV in Information Technology ICT40120 and the Advanced Diploma of Information Technology ICT60220 are ideal for furthering your expertise. These programs can help you climb the career ladder, opening the door to numerous job opportunities, including roles such as IT Support Officer and Cloud Engineer.
